GTP-C & GTP-U are not supported by cloud filter due
to limited resource of HW, this patch enables GTP-C
and GTP-U cloud filter by replacing inner_mac and
TUNNEL_KEY.
This configuration will be set when adding GTP-C or
GTP-U filter rules, and it will be invalid only by
NIC core reset.
